La Nuova Raccomandata con Ricevuta di Ritorno – Live in Elba
La Nuova Raccomandata con Ricevuta di Ritorno, a new incarnation of the legendary Italian progressive rock group Raccomandata con Ricevuta di Ritorno, has a new album titled Live in Elba.

In 2013, several progressive rock artists got together to celebrate the life of Pino “Trick” Catanzaro, a popular figure who grew up in Elba and was a long-time friend of musician and painter Luciano Regoli. The celebration took place at Teatro Napoleonico dei Vigilanti in Portoferraio, featuring two of Italy’s leading bands; La Maschera di Cera and La Nuova Raccomandata con Ricevuta di Ritorno.

On Live in Elba, the lioneup of La Nuova Raccomandata con Ricevuta di Ritorno includes historical members Luciano Regoli and Nanni Civitenga joined by some of the best musicians in today’s Italian jazz-rock scene such as Andy Bartolucci (drums & percussions), Maurizio Pariotti (keyboards, piano, programming), Cristina Cioni (choir, backing vocals), Bruno Previtali (guitars), Alessandro Tomei (flute, tenor sax). The repertoire includes material from the classic debut “Per… un mondo di cristallo” and the recent “Il Pittore Volante“, two releases divided by nearly 40 years, but joined by the same unmistakable italian progressive flavor.

Live in Elba includes live photos taken during the concert, a short story by Luciano Regoli about the old days between the 1960s and 1970s, and the adventures of the young Regoli and his friend “Trick”.

The CD version features bonus tracks “La spiaggia” from “Il Pittore Volante” and the cover songs of “Babe I’m gonna leave you” (Led Zeppelin), “Fire” (Arthur Brown) and “If six was nine” (Jimi Hendrix), this last one played by the opening group Four Jumps in Pot with Luciano Regoli singing with them.
